How does encryption protect data?

Explanation:
Encryption protects data primarily by transforming it into a non-readable format. This process ensures that only authorized users can access the information, as the transformed data appears as a random assortment of characters and symbols to anyone who does not have the decryption key. When data is encrypted, it is essentially scrambled in such a way that it becomes unintelligible to unauthorized individuals or systems. This transformation is crucial in protecting sensitive information from interception or unauthorized access, as it renders the data useless without the means to decrypt it back to its original form. While other methods, such as backup procedures, data compression, and secure storage, contribute to data security and management, they do not provide the same level of protection against unauthorized access as encryption does. It is through this decisive conversion to a non-readable format that encryption secures data from potential breaches and maintains confidentiality.
